Output 2516aae94f803eff8f69f9066f7d067377c4621dbd40e8adbb338041ac091e4b:24

value
578502
script pubkey
OP_0 OP_PUSHBYTES_20 6a43e6bae47153baf9a31542397892a5d76ae34f
address
bc1qdfp7dwhyw9fm47drz4prj7yj5htk4c604kfjjk
transaction
2516aae94f803eff8f69f9066f7d067377c4621dbd40e8adbb338041ac091e4b
spent
true